Heide Paula Perlman (born September 22, 1951 in Brooklyn, New York) is best known for her work as a television script writer. Perlman began work as a writer on the sitcom Cheers from 1982 through 1986; since then she has worked as a writer, producer and/or story editor on The Tracey Ullman Show, Frasier, The George Carlin Show, Stacked, The Bill Engvall Show and among others.[1] She has won two Primetime Emmy Awards and has been nominated for eight others.[2]

She is the younger sister of Cheers actress Rhea Perlman.
